用谷歌浏览器时,先编译原先样式,然后没有清理缓存; 在清理完缓存后,css文件就起了作用。按住CTRL+F5或者打开设置清除缓存。 ...
react 小白编程 做项目时遇到了个问题,无论我怎么查看我的action reducer 还是 dispatch 函数,都没有发现有什么毛病。但是 debugger 的时候,state 改变了,页面却没有变。 困扰了我好长时间,后来发现是因为我在使用 reducer 修改 state 的时候,遇到了一个极大的错误 我要修改的 state 值是一个数组,而我却在原数组上使用 Splice 进行修改 ...
2018-06-04 10:28 0 3338 推荐指数:
用谷歌浏览器时,先编译原先样式,然后没有清理缓存; 在清理完缓存后,css文件就起了作用。按住CTRL+F5或者打开设置清除缓存。 ...
有两个按钮,按钮上有个number属性,当此值为偶数时,按钮显示为红色。 最初的数据如下:"a": [{ name: "one" },{ name: "two",number: 2 }] 现象如下:当点击第一个按钮时,数据变了,界面却没有相应刷新;这是再点击第二个按钮,发现第二个按钮是正常 ...
上面我们在改变todos中的数据的时候,页面则没有改变,我们可以使用下面的方法来解决这个问题 1.使用全局set方法 this.$set(this.todos, 0, {name: 'zz', age: 12}) 或 this.$set ...
https://blog.csdn.net/qq_40259641/article/details/105275819 ...
以上是JS代码 下面的是C# 代码 返回是success, 不过查看数据库并没有更新数据 ...
父组件每次改变state,都会触发render,然后触发子组件,如果不用触发子组件可以用 shouldComponentUpdate声明周期控制 在子组件里放入: shouldComponentUpdate(nextPros ...
React框架有一个特性,当React检测到页面内容有变化是,它会自动刷新页面,并且自动更新页面中需要更新的部分。但是React并不会把更新的内容挂在真是的DOM上,因此我们单单对页面数据或者组件改动是,并不会看到页面有任何变化。React提供了组件的一个私有的,其他任何组件没有权限改变的属性 ...
主要作用:可以在子组件中刷新父组件,或者想从子组件传值到父组件 子组件可以像例子中这样直接绑定事件触发,或者在其他方法中调用this.props.updateParent() 原文链 ...